AGO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2017 in Review

276 of the 4,410 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Assured Guaranty (AGO) for Q4 2017, worth a combined $3.82B — down 11% from $4.31B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 36 funds opened new AGO positions and 34 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 103 added to existing stakes and 106 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Goldman Sachs, adding an estimated $36.3M. The largest seller was Wellington Management Group, cutting an estimated $57.3M.
